创建excel表格

1.导入python库

import openpyxl

import datatime

2.在内存创建一个excel文档

book=openpyxl.Workbook()

3.取第0个工作表

sheet = book.active

4.工作表取名sample1

sheet.title = "sample1"

5.工作表添加内容

dataRows=((1,2,3,4),(100,200,300,400),[],['1000',datatime.datatime.now(),'ok'])

for row in dataRows:

  sheet.append(row)

6.设置B列宽度

sheet.column_dimensions['B'].width = len(str(sheet['B4'].value))

7.设置行的高度

sheet.row_dimensions[2].height = 48

8.单元格的值为公式

sheet['E1'].value = "=sum(A1:D1)"

9.添加一张工作表

sheet2 = book.create_sheet("sample2")

sheet2 = book.create_sheet("sample0,0")

sheet3 = book.copy_worksheet(sheet)

10.删除一张工作表

book.remove_sheet(book["sample2"])

11.保存文件

book.save("xxxxx")

 

 

 

posted @ 2021-07-29 10:55  一蓑烟雨任平生生  阅读(341)  评论(0)    收藏  举报